Echoes at Dawn by Maya Banks Review

Title: Echoes at Dawn

Author: Maya Banks

First published April 16, 2012

336 pages, ebook

ISBN: 9781101568583 (ISBN10: 1101568585)

Rating: 4.26

Overview

Leah Carter is on the run, desperate to escape a dangerous organization that has been exploiting her unique ability to read minds. With her only connection to the world, her telepathic bond with her sister, now severed, Leah is alone and vulnerable.

Enter Nathan, a member of the elite KGI team, tasked with bringing Leah to safety. Nathan is unprepared for the intense attraction he feels for Leah, and he’s determined to protect her at all costs.

With Nathan by her side, Leah finds a glimmer of hope in a world turned upside down. But as danger creeps closer, they must fight to stay one step ahead of their enemies.

In Echoes at Dawn, Maya Banks weaves a thrilling tale of love, danger, and the unbreakable bond between two people caught in the crosshairs of fate.
